Choosing the Perfect Period Cast Iron Radiator for Your Home


A period cast iron radiator can add a distinctive feature to your room. Not only are these very functional pieces that can efficiently heat rooms but they also have a great aesthetic appeal. There is something very charming about a cast iron radiator that can add character to any interior design project.

Designs and Styles

If you want to include a cast iron radiator in your room design then you will have a choice of styles and colours available. Traditional period cast iron radiator will typically by in white or black. If you are buying a reclaimed cast iron radiator set for a period style home then it is best to stick to these more authentic colour options.


You can also get a number of very distinctive finishes including metal effects (such as antique gold and copper) and bold primary colours. This is ideal if you are creating a unique interior design and want something a little more special for your room heating.

Reclaimed Cast Iron Radiators

In terms of costs it can be cheaper to opt for new cast iron radiators. The reclaimed radiators are often old enough to be classed as antiques and this can push prices up. It can also be expensive renovating old radiators and making them usable again. However if you want an authentic period design then reclaimed radiators are a good choice.

Don't get confused between reclaimed radiators and second hand ones. A reclaimed cast iron radiator will have been tidied up and pressure tested to check for leaks. You can buy reclaimed radiators from specialist providers that are ready to be plumbed straight into your system. They will have guarantee against leaking which will protect your investment.

A second hand cast iron radiator can be a very cheap option but you will have no idea whether or not it is usable until it has been plumbed into your system. These radiators will be available in car boot sales, classified ads and auctions (both online and offline). They will not have been tested by a specialist in most cases and you will be taking a real gamble on whether or not you are wasting your money.

New Cast Iron Radiators

New cast iron radiators are crafted using a mix of traditional skills and modern techniques. This creates attractive and durable radiators that will look great and last a long time. New cast iron radiators can be crafted to traditional period designs and are also available in some more modern options.

Buying a new cast iron radiator set can be expensive but you will be paying for a brand new and thoroughly tested product. New radiators will come with manufacturer's warrantees so if they do not work for some reason you should be able to get replacements. This can save a lot of time and effort.
